What is the range of the function f(x)=3/4 |x|-3

All real numbers
All real numbers less then or equal to 3
All real numbers less than or equal to -3
All real numbers greater than or equal to -3​

Answer:

The range of the given function is:

  • All real numbers greater than or equal to -3​

Explanation:

We are given a modulus function f(x) by:


f(x)=(3)/(4)|x|-3

From the graph of the function we may see that the graph continuously decreases from x= ∞ to x=0 and at x=0 the function attains the values ,

f(0)= -3

and then it again increases continuously and goes to infinity.

Hence, the function covers all the real values between -3 to ∞

i.e. The range of the function in interval form is: [-3,∞)

Hence, the answer is:

All real numbers greater than or equal to -3​
